Output c380296009f79972409469d6c90f28d1e57630c40619d304b3bf7514a63c5f96:2

value
157924778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fbba74438acdd86cf8982890ba00b7b99b57245 OP_EQUAL
address
3Eo1MMuWRBpki1DQSQiPSjTGumRoec5Aq7
transaction
c380296009f79972409469d6c90f28d1e57630c40619d304b3bf7514a63c5f96
spent
true